    Over the last 10 years, we have had 4 boys attend this school and the last 3 years have been a terrible experience for our middle schoolers. First, many of the teachers do not have teaching degrees and they lack the ability to manage the classroom and the ability to actually teach the material. For example, the LA teacher does not even provide grading rubrics and many A students do really poorly in her class as they do not know the expectations. The Athletic director has made so many mistakes over his tenure that many students have quit playing school sports. One of the lunchroom monitors is so full of disdain for the children that she frequently and angrily approaches kids and yells at them. Even worse is that the administration insists on enforcing an archaic and punitive discipline system that sets children up to fail, especially boys with high energy and/ADHD, which happens to be numerous athletic boys. They are threatening suspension and expulsion, and actually suspending boys who have minor write-ups, nothing major. They do this in the name of mercy and justice, but what they are doing is the exact opposite. They are actually driving our future leaders away from the Catholic faith instead of learning how to deal with high energy teenagers, which such techniques are readily available to them.

    While there were may parts of St. Hubert's that we enjoyed such as the community, facilities, and many of the teachers as a whole the staff and administration do not look at each child as an individual as they say they do. In elementary specifically you are in a one size fits all environment and if it doesn't fit you than they are unwilling to provide differential options. Staff moral has great diminished over the time our children attended leaving teachers with less incentive to go above and beyond. It is not the same St. Hubert School as it was years ago.
